About National Geographic Kids: We teach kids about the world and how it works, empowering them to succeed and to make it a better place.
Nat Geo Kids inspires young adventurers to explore the world through award-winning magazines, books, apps, games, toys, videos, events, and a website, and is the only kids brand with a world-class scientific organization at its core. National Geographic Kids magazine (10 issues per year) and Little Kids magazine (six issues per year) are photo-driven publications and are available on newsstands or by subscription in print and on tablets. About The KIDZ Page: theKidzpage has been online since 1998. We have over 1,500 free jigsaw puzzle games that kids can play online, over 900 free kid's printable coloring pages, more than 2,000 free pieces of children's clipart and enough free online kids games to keep kids busy and entertained for many hours :)
This children's website is made up of over 5,000 pages of fun, learning and activities, and an average of 1 to 2 new fun games and other kids' activities are added daily. About How Stuff Works:HowStuffWorks got its start in 1998 at a college professor's kitchen table. From there, we quickly grew into an award-winning source of unbiased, reliable, easy-to-understand answers and explanations of how the world actually works.
Today, our writers, editors, podcasters and video hosts share all the things we're most excited to learn about with nearly 30 million visitors to the site each month. Learn more...
